Q.

Which of the following statements illustrates the law of multiple proportions?

a

An element forms two oxides, XO and XO2  containing 50 % and 60 % oxygen respectively. The ratio of masses of oxygen, which combines with 1 g of element is 2 : 3.

b

One volume of nitrogen always combines with three volumes of oxygen to form two volumes of ammonia.

c

3.47 g of BaCl2 reacts with 2.36 g of Na2SO4 to give 3.88 g of BaSO4 and 1.95 g of NaCl.

d

20 mL of ammonia gives 10 volumes of N2 and 30 volumes of H2 at constant temperature and pressure.

answer is A.

Detailed Solution

In XO, 50 g of element combines with 50 g of oxygen.
1 g of element combines with 1 g of oxygen.
In XO2, 40 g of element combines with 60 g of oxygen.
1 g of element combines with 1.5 g of oxygen.
Thus, ratio of masses of oxygen which combines with 1 g of element is 1 : 1.5 or 2 : 3. This is in accordance with the law of multiple proportions. 

In second option, Gay Lussac's law of gaseous volume is followed. 

In third option, law of conservation of mass is followed while in fourth option, Avogadro's law is followed.
